    Not a good place to be

    I worked in Santa Domingo, It is not a good place to live
    and work. The hotels and most businesses that handle
    money have men with shotguns at the doors. Disease and poverty are rampant. The north east end of the island is for the tourists, only the workers are allowed
    at the tourist areas. It's an area they try to keep clean and crime free. WE won't talk about Haiti!
